Transaction 8081ba6eb65d638acc251dd2b3e15ab2ec99d178fb0bd05754ae86151086568d
1 Input
1 Output
-
8081ba6eb65d638acc251dd2b3e15ab2ec99d178fb0bd05754ae86151086568d:0
- value
- 406073484
- script pubkey
- OP_0 OP_PUSHBYTES_20 39835890749a403f9a003b80109e5ecdb0fb9551
- address
- bc1q8xp43yr5nfqrlxsq8wqpp8j7ekc0h923pahkgu